About World of Warships Legends

World of Warships Legends is a single player and multiplayer tactical shooter game with a historical theme. It was developed by Wargaming Group Limited and was released on August 12, 2019. It received mostly positive reviews from both critics and players.

Experience epic naval action in World of Warships: Legends, a global multiplayer free-to-play online game where you can master the seas in history's greatest warships! Recruit legendary commanders, upgrade your vessels and stake your claim to naval supremacy with or against players around the world. PS Plus is not required for online play, so there's nothing stopping you from setting sail today!

  • Smooth and fun gameplay with satisfying tactical naval combat involving teamwork, positioning, and distinct ship classes.
  • Cross-platform play and cross-progression work well, allowing players to play with friends on different platforms and keep progress.
  • The PC port improves graphics and performance over consoles, and the game is accessible for new players with faster-paced battles and smaller maps.
  • The game suffers from heavy grind, aggressive monetization, and significant pay-to-win elements, especially related to premium ships and commanders.
  • Matchmaking is often unbalanced, with smurfing and veteran players dominating lower tiers, creating a frustrating experience for new players.
  • Technical issues persist including crashes, controller support bugs, UI problems, lack of widescreen/ultrawide support, and occasional server instability.

    The gameplay of World of Warships: Legends is generally praised for its accessible, fast-paced, and action-packed naval combat with smooth mechanics and varied ship roles, offering strategic depth and rewarding progression. However, some players find the grind heavy, matchmaking inconsistent, and monetization intrusive, while others note occasional clunkiness and a learning curve that may overwhelm beginners. Overall, it provides an engaging experience especially for those willing to invest time mastering its systems.

    The game's graphics receive mixed feedback, with some praising the smooth performance, impressive water effects, and overall visuals, while others criticize downgraded textures, oversaturation, and a lack of detail compared to the main World of Warships PC version. Optimization varies by platform and hardware, with recommendations to lower settings for better performance on older PCs. Overall, the graphics are decent but fall short of expectations for some players, especially those familiar with the original game.

    The grinding in the game is widely seen as very time-consuming and often tedious, especially at early and higher tiers, with locked progression and expensive in-game costs making it feel hostile to new players. However, many note that grinding helps develop skill, and obtaining premium ships or commanders can alleviate the grind, making the experience more enjoyable for those willing to invest time or money. Overall, the extensive grind contributes to long-term longevity but may deter those seeking a more balanced or free-to-play friendly experience.

    Monetization in the game is often seen as aggressive and heavy, with prominent microtransactions, premium currency, and expensive content creating a grindy experience unless players spend substantial money. However, despite these criticisms and occasional paywall frustrations, many users find the core gameplay enjoyable and note that microtransactions generally do not impact game performance or balance significantly. Overall, while monetization detracts from the experience for some, the game remains fun and accessible for those willing to play without paying.

    Optimization reviews are mixed, with many users reporting smooth performance and rare lag on PC, while others experience poor performance and stuttering, especially on Linux or at high settings with ray tracing. Console versions appear to be capped at 30 or 60 fps with compromised graphics, suggesting subpar optimization. Overall, PC optimization remains inconsistent, with some improvements noted but ongoing issues for certain setups.
